Elected Official
An individual who has been chosen by voters to hold a public office through a democratic electoral process.
Direct Democracy
Direct democracy is a form of government in which citizens directly participate in the decision-making processes, rather than through elected representatives, often through referendums and initiatives.
Gerrymandering
The manipulation of electoral district boundaries to favor one party or class.
Retrospective Voting
A theory in political science where voters make decisions based on a politician's or a political party's past performance rather than future promises.
